BMW X3 xDrive 20i Crossover Cars
The BMW X3 xDrive 20i Crossover 4WD is a refined and versatile luxury compact SUV, designed to meet the demands of drivers across the United Kingdom. Combining BMW’s hallmark driving dynamics with the practicality and comfort needed for UK roads and weather conditions, this model stands out as an excellent choice for urban commuters, families, and adventure enthusiasts alike.
Under the bonnet, the X3 xDrive 20i features a turbocharged 2.0-liter four-cylinder petrol engine delivering a smooth and responsive drive. With an estimated output of around 181 horsepower, it provides brisk acceleration that is well-suited to motorway overtaking as well as stop-start city traffic in places like London or Manchester. The vehicle benefits from BMW’s xDrive intelligent all-wheel-drive system (4x4), which continuously monitors road grip levels and optimally distributes torque between front and rear wheels. This technology enhances stability and traction on slippery surfaces commonly encountered during wet or icy UK winters, particularly on rural or country lanes where road conditions can vary significantly.
